Playnet and Cornered Rat Software have released info on their upcoming v1.9 update patch to the massively multiplayer online game, World War II Online. In v1.9 we will see new tons of fixes & tweaks as well as new gameplay additions such as : depot spawning, porting the Unity 3D graphics engine to OpenGL, adding another 40 cities/towns/ports to already the largest online world, debris additions from shell hits on aircraft, shell ejections in first and third person and more battlefield explosions and plenty plenty more (thanks Python61). Earlier this week there was word of the promotional
Underworld: Bloodlines Halflife mod, but as it turns out Lucky Chicken Games is working on an action game based on Sony Pictures' upcoming action flick 'Underworld'. The game is under development for Xbox as well as PC and is scheduled for release simultaniously with the movie in September. Read more for a batch of (Bloodrayne looking) screens ...
